- Unit of measurement B2 formal scientific
The molecular weight of a substance expressed in grams; the basic unit of amount of substance adopted under the Systeme International d'Unites.
- One mole of carbon-12 has a mass of exactly 12 grams.
- The chemist measured out one mole of sodium chloride.
- Avogadro's number defines the number of particles in one mole.

- Spy B2 formal
A spy who works against enemy espionage, often by infiltrating an organization.
- The mole was discovered passing secrets to a foreign government.
- He worked as a mole within the intelligence agency for years.
- The double agent was suspected of being a mole.

- Spicy sauce B1 formal culinary
A spicy sauce often containing chocolate, commonly used in Mexican cuisine.
- Mole poblano is a traditional Mexican dish.
- She prepared chicken with a rich mole sauce.
- The mole had a complex flavor of chili and chocolate.

- Skin spot A2 formal
A small congenital pigmented spot on the skin, typically brown or black.
- She has a mole on her left cheek.
- The doctor examined the mole for any signs of cancer.
- He noticed a new mole on his arm.

- Protective structure B2 formal
A protective structure of stone or concrete extending from shore into the water to prevent a beach from washing away.
- The mole protected the harbor from strong waves.
- They built a mole to stop coastal erosion.
- The old mole was reinforced with concrete blocks.

- Burrowing mammal A2 formal
A small velvety-furred burrowing mammal having small eyes and fossorial forefeet.
- A mole dug tunnels across the garden.
- Moles are rarely seen above ground.
- The mole's fur is adapted for underground life.
